17. Electrology is the only method of permanent hair removal. www.permanenthairremovalonline.net
18. Electrology is performed by inserting a hair thin metal probe into the hair follicle and delivering electricity through the probe. www.permanenthairremovalonline.net
19. The damage caused by the electrocution of the cells producing hair will stop hair growth from those cells permanently. www.permanenthairremovalonline.net
20. The process, if done correctly will not cause the skin to be punctured in any way. www.permanenthairremovalonline.net
21. By damaging the cells responsible for hair growth permanent hair removal will be achieved. www.permanenthairremovalonline.net

29. The general principle behind permanent hair removal or reduction with laser is fairly simple. www.permanenthairremovalonline.net
30. A laser light designed to target only dark matter on the subject. www.permanenthairremovalonline.net
31. Since hair is generally darker than the skin this will be affected by the laser. www.permanenthairremovalonline.net
32. The laser cause the hair to be heated and cause damage to the follicle responsible for hair growth. www.permanenthairremovalonline.net
33. The ideal subject for permanent hair removal with laser is a light skinned person with dark hair. www.permanenthairremovalonline.net
34. However, the technology is still developing and is now able to target dark hairs on dark skinned subjects as well. www.permanenthairremovalonline.net
35. A cheaper and faster method called intense pulsed light or IPL is now emerging. www.permanenthairremovalonline.net
37. This cheaper and faster method of permanent hair removal is based on intense light for very short durations of time. www.permanenthairremovalonline.net
38. The general principle is not to far removed from laser hair removal. www.permanenthairremovalonline.net
39. The objective is to cause damage to the hair follicles preventing further hair growth. www.permanenthairremovalonline.net
40. Experts in the field generally consider IPL to be as efficient as laser hair removal. www.permanenthairremovalonline.net
